can you buy imitrex in mexico can you buy imitrex over the counter imitrex comprar sumatriptan nasal spray price in india can you buy imitrex in mexico can i buy imitrex over the counter can you buy imitrex over the counter is imitrex over the counter order sumatriptan online can you buy imitrex over the counter imitrex kaufen can i buy sumatriptan in spain sumatriptan buy online india can i buy sumatriptan online is there a generic for imitrex order sumatriptan online imitrex nasal spray price imitrex kaufen imitrex nasal spray discontinued can you buy imitrex over the counter prix imitrex belgique can you buy imitrex over the counter can you buy imitrex over the counter can i buy imitrex over the counter can you buy imitrex over the counter can you buy imitrex over the counter prix imitrex belgique can you buy sumatriptan over the counter is sumatriptan the same as imitrex imitrex nasal spray can i buy sumatriptan in boots can you buy imitrex over the counter is there a generic for imitrex can you buy sumatriptan over the counter in australia can i buy sumatriptan online